ERW Pipe HSN Code (7306): HS Code Classification Guide for Steel Pipes

Date:2026-06-09View:5655Tags:erw pipe hs code 7306

1. What Is the HSN Code for ERW Pipe?


Most ERW steel pipes are classified under HS Code 7306, a tariff heading covering welded steel tubes, pipes, and hollow sections. Because ERW pipe is produced from steel coil and formed through a welding process, it is generally distinguished from seamless pipe, which falls under HS Code 7304.

HS Code 7306 is a broad tariff heading rather than a single declaration code. Different subheadings are used for carbon steel pipe, alloy steel pipe, square tube, rectangular tube, and other welded tubular products.

The table below lists the HSN codes most commonly associated with ERW steel pipe products and related welded steel sections.


2. ERW Pipe HSN Code List


Final classification should be confirmed against the importing country's tariff schedule. The exact classification may vary depending on the product specification and local customs requirements, but these codes are frequently referenced in international trade and customs declarations.


Product Type HSN Code
Carbon Steel ERW Pipe 730630
Alloy Steel ERW Pipe 730650
Square ERW Tube 730661
Rectangular ERW Tube 730661
Other Welded Steel Pipe 730690
Steel Pipe Fittings 730791


Among these classifications, codes such as 73063090, 73065000, 73066100, and 73069090 are commonly seen in customs documents for steel pipe exports.


3. How to Choose the Correct HSN Code for ERW Pipe


For ERW pipe, the HSN code is determined by the pipe’s actual characteristics, not by the term “ERW” alone. Classification is generally based on material, shape, and manufacturing method.


3.1 Material

① Carbon steel ERW pipe

Most carbon steel ERW pipes are classified under HS Code 7306.


② Alloy steel ERW pipe

If the pipe contains alloying elements such as chromium, molybdenum, or nickel, Alloy steel ERW pipes are often classified under different 7306 subheadings according to their chemical composition.


③ Galvanized ERW pipe

The zinc coating can affect classification in some tariff schedules. In many cases, galvanized welded tubes are declared under a separate subheading from uncoated carbon steel pipe.


3.2 Shape

① Round ERW pipe

Standard round pipe is the baseline product type under heading 7306 and is widely used for pipelines, structural work, and mechanical applications.


② Square and rectangular hollow sections

These are classified separately from round pipe in many customs systems because they are considered structural hollow sections rather than ordinary round tubing.


3.3 Manufacturing Method

Welded pipes, including ERW, SSAW, and LSAW products, are generally classified under HS Code 7306.

Seamless steel pipe is classified under HS Code 7304.


4. ERW Pipe HS Code vs Seamless Pipe HS Code


The key difference in customs classification is whether the pipe is welded or seamless.


Pipe Type HS Code
ERW Steel Pipe 7306
Seamless Steel Pipe 7304


ERW pipe is manufactured from steel strip or coil and joined by electric resistance welding. As a welded tubular product, it is classified under HS Code 7306.

Seamless pipe is produced from a solid steel billet without a longitudinal weld seam. It falls under HS Code 7304, which covers seamless tubes, pipes, and hollow profiles.


When declaring steel pipe for customs clearance, the manufacturing method is one of the primary factors used to determine whether heading 7304 or 7306 applies. Product specifications, mill certificates, and purchase documents are commonly used to verify the correct classification.


5. Common HS Classification Errors for ERW Pipe


Most HS code errors for ERW pipe are caused by incorrect product descriptions rather than the code itself.

Common issues include:

① Declaring welded ERW pipe as seamless pipe.

② Using the same classification for carbon steel and alloy steel products.

③ Omitting pipe shape when declaring square or rectangular hollow sections.

④ Providing only the product name "ERW pipe" without material grade, dimensions, or manufacturing details.


6. Example of an ERW Pipe Customs Description


A customs declaration for ERW pipe typically includes the product type, material grade, dimensions, country of origin, and HS code.

Example:

ERW Carbon Steel Pipe

ASTM A53 Grade B

Outside Diameter: 114.3 mm

Wall Thickness: 6.02 mm

Length: 6 m

HS Code: 73063090

Country of Origin: China

Depending on the importing country, additional details such as coating type, end finish, or product standard may also be required.


7. FAQS


Q1: What is HS code 73063090?

73063090 is a commonly used tariff code for certain welded steel pipes, including many ERW pipe products. The exact classification may vary depending on national tariff schedules.


Q2: Are square ERW tubes classified differently from round ERW pipes?

Yes. Many customs tariff systems use separate subheadings for square and rectangular hollow sections. Although both products fall under HS Code 7306, the final classification may differ.


Q3: Does galvanized ERW pipe use a different HS code?

Galvanized ERW pipe is generally classified within HS Code 7306. Depending on the country's tariff schedule, the coating may affect the final subheading used for customs declaration.


Q4: Is the HS code the same in every country?

The first six digits are based on the international Harmonized System (HS) and are generally consistent worldwide. Many countries add additional digits for national tariff and statistical purposes.
